PIC W35FP, Flush Pancake (paddle) seal for 3" flange connection. Previously known as the MP type seal. Best price/performance selection.

Extended seal for 2" flange connection. Allows diaph to extend through mounting nozzle to be flush with inside of tank wall, eliminating cavities where plugging could occur. Small diameter diaph.s' displacement capability limits temperature range and/or capillary length.
